Understanding Cloud-Managed Services

Outside specialists offer cloud-managed services to oversee an organization’s cloud infrastructure. These services cover security, monitoring, maintenance, optimization, and support.

Ensuring a strong, safe, and optimally operating cloud infrastructure will free up companies to concentrate on their main areas of expertise.

The essential components of cloud-managed services include:

  1. Cloud Monitoring and Management: Cloud management and monitoring are the ongoing observation of cloud resources to ensure availability and the best possible performance. Aspects of monitoring include CPU, memory, and network performance.
  2. Security Management: Security management involves implementing and upholding security protocols to protect against dangers and weaknesses. This includes firewalls, intrusion detection, and regular security assessments.
  3. Cost Management and Optimization: Recognizing areas to cut costs and make the most of cloud spending. This includes using pricing and discount schemes and examining consumption trends.
  4. Disaster Recovery and Backup: This ensures that data is routinely backed up and can be swiftly restored in the case of a catastrophe. Part of this is developing and implementing recovery strategies.
  5. Compliance Management: This ensures that the cloud environment follows industry practices and the relevant legal requirements through audits and proper documentation.
  6. Performance Optimization: The optimal performance of the cloud environment is achieved through ongoing adjustment. This can include allocating more resources and putting performance improvements in place.

Cloud Security Measures Provided by Cloud-Managed Services

Cloud-managed services provide the following security measures to reinforce the safety of organizations:

1. Advanced Threat Detection and Prevention

Cloud-managed services typically offer advanced threat detection and prevention as part of their cloud security features. Using cutting-edge instruments and technology, such as machine learning and artificial intelligence (AI), these services detect and lessen possible risks before they cause damage.

Businesses that take this proactive tack can lower their risk of data breaches and other security vulnerabilities and keep one step ahead of criminal activities.

2. Continuous Monitoring and Incident Response

Ongoing cloud environment monitoring helps a company detect odd behavior or possible security breaches. Monitoring risks around the clock minimizes the potential impact on the company.

Providers of cloud-managed services are prepared to react quickly and efficiently to a security breach, minimizing harm and offering fast system restoration.

3. Vulnerability Management

Cloud-managed service providers conduct extensive evaluations to find weaknesses in the cloud infrastructure and ensure that all systems are running the most recent security patches. This proactive strategy deters hackers from taking advantage of known flaws to obtain illegal access to a company’s systems and data.

4. Data Encryption and Secure Access Controls

Any company using cloud services should give data protection high importance. Providers of cloud-managed services have implemented strong data encryption techniques to protect private data while it is in transit and at rest. They also impose stringent access restrictions to guarantee that only authorized staff may access important systems and data, preserving a secure cloud environment.

1. Onboarding a Customer IT Infrastructure

Successful onboarding sets the stage for a fruitful partnership between the managed service provider (MSP) and the client. It involves meticulously understanding the client’s IT infrastructure, applications, workflows, and business objectives. By conducting a thorough assessment, the MSP can develop a tailored onboarding strategy that seamlessly meets the client’s expectations for their cloud infrastructure to minimize disruptions. Clear communication, effective project management, and a well-defined transition plan are crucial for a smooth onboarding process.

2. Setting up the Right Proactive Monitoring

Proactive monitoring forms the backbone of effective cloud management, enabling MSPs to anticipate and address potential issues before they escalate. Implementing robust monitoring tools and strategies allows MSPs to continuously monitor the performance, health, and security of the cloud environment. By proactively identifying and resolving issues, such as performance bottlenecks, security vulnerabilities, or capacity constraints, MSPs ensure optimal uptime, reliability, and performance for their clients’ applications and services.

3. Preventive Maintenance as per Technology Stacks

Preventive maintenance involves regular upkeep and optimization of the cloud infrastructure to prevent downtime and performance degradation. MSPs employ proactive maintenance routines tailored to the specific technology stacks used by their clients. This includes software updates, patch management, DB Indexing, log rotation, security enhancements, and optimization of resource utilization. By staying ahead of potential issues and keeping the infrastructure in peak condition, MSPs minimize disruptions and ensure a seamless user experience.

4. Advising Cost, Security, Reliability, and Performance Recommendations

Beyond technical management, MSPs play a crucial advisory role in guiding clients on cost optimization, security best practices, reliability improvements, and performance enhancements. By conducting scheduled assessments and audits, MSPs identify opportunities to optimize costs, strengthen security posture, enhance reliability, and improve performance. Through effective change management practices, MSPs collaborate with clients to implement recommended changes, balancing business objectives with technical requirements.

5. Keeping the Technical Component Up to Date by Technology Lifecycle Management

Technology evolves rapidly, and staying up-to-date with the latest advancements is crucial for maintaining a competitive edge. MSPs leverage technology lifecycle management practices to ensure that the technical components of the cloud environment remain current and relevant. This involves assessing the lifecycle status of software, hardware, and infrastructure components, planning for upgrades or migrations, and implementing changes promptly to ensure optimal performance. By embracing innovation and staying ahead of technology trends, MSPs help clients harness the full potential of the cloud.

Best Practices for Implementing Cloud Security

Businesses that want to make full use of cloud-managed services also need to follow cloud security best practices. These include:

1. Regular Security Audits and Assessments

Routine security audits and assessments must find potential vulnerabilities in the cloud infrastructure. These evaluations can be carried out, and cloud-managed services companies can produce comprehensive reports with suggestions for enhancing security measures.

2. Employee Training and Awareness

Human error is a leading cause of security breaches. Businesses that wish to impart to their employees the need for cybersecurity and the best practices for maintaining a safe cloud environment need to fund training and awareness initiatives regularly.

3. Multi-Factor Authentication (MFA)

By making users present many forms of identity before accessing important systems and data, multi-factor authentication (MFA) adds an additional level of protection. Suppliers of cloud-managed services can assist companies in putting MFA into place to improve their security position.

4. Regular Data Backups

Business continuity in the case of a security breach depends critically on routine data backups. Providers of cloud-managed services provide frequent backups of data and fast restoration of it in case of need.

5. Continuous Monitoring and Threat Intelligence

Maintaining efficient cloud computing security requires staying current on the newest threats and weaknesses. Suppliers of cloud-managed services provide threat intelligence and ongoing monitoring to keep companies aware of and safe from new risks.
